Jens Glastrup is a scholar working on Archeology, Conservation and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Jens Glastrup has authored 20 papers receiving a total of 376 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Archeology, 6 papers in Conservation and 4 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Jens Glastrup’s work include Conservation Techniques and Studies (6 papers), Cultural Heritage Materials Analysis (5 papers) and Building materials and conservation (3 papers). Jens Glastrup is often cited by papers focused on Conservation Techniques and Studies (6 papers), Cultural Heritage Materials Analysis (5 papers) and Building materials and conservation (3 papers). Jens Glastrup collaborates with scholars based in Denmark, Italy and Australia. Jens Glastrup's co-authors include Morten Ryhl-Svendsen, Helge Egsgaard, Yvonne Shashoua, Søren Hvilsted, Kjeld Ingvorsen, Kasper Urup Kjeldsen, Charlotte Jacobsen, Ann‐Dorit Moltke Sørensen, Betül Yeşiltaş and Ditte Baun Hermund and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Chromatography A, Atmospheric Environment and Polymer Degradation and Stability.
